What is Microsoft.opn.technologies.dll?

A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file is a type of file that contains code and data that can be used by more than one program at the same time. It allows programs to share resources instead of needing to have separate copies of the code for each program. In the case of microsoft.opn.technologies.dll, it is a specific DLL file related to Microsoft Message Analyzer.

The microsoft.opn.technologies.dll file plays a crucial role in the functionality of Microsoft Message Analyzer. It contains code and data that the Message Analyzer software needs to run properly. Without this DLL file, the software may not be able to perform its tasks as it relies on the resources and functions provided by microsoft.opn.technologies.dll.

DLL files, despite their significant role in system functionality, can sometimes trigger system error messages. The subsequent list features some the most common DLL error messages that users may encounter.

  • Cannot register microsoft.opn.technologies.dll: This error is indicative of the system's inability to correctly register the DLL file. This might occur due to issues with the Windows Registry or because the DLL file itself is corrupt or improperly installed.
  • The file microsoft.opn.technologies.dll is missing: The error indicates that the DLL file, essential for the proper function of an application or the system itself, is not located in its expected directory.
  • Microsoft.opn.technologies.dll Access Violation: This points to a situation where a process has attempted to interact with microsoft.opn.technologies.dll in a way that violates system or application rules. This might be due to incorrect programming, memory overflows, or the running process lacking necessary permissions.
  • Microsoft.opn.technologies.dll could not be loaded: This error suggests that the system was unable to load the DLL file into memory. This could happen due to file corruption, incompatibility, or because the file is missing or incorrectly installed.
  • This application failed to start because microsoft.opn.technologies.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error occurs when an application tries to access a DLL file that doesn't exist in the system. Reinstalling the application can restore the missing DLL file if it was included in the original software package.
